How much do seasonal fly in fly out j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for seasonal fly in fly out in the United States is $15.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$17.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Seasonal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) worker, and why are they important?

To excel as a Seasonal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) worker, you typically need relevant trade or industry qualifications, physical fitness, and experience in remote or industrial settings. Familiarity with safety management systems, heavy machinery, and certifications such as White Card or First Aid are often required. Strong adaptability, resilience, and teamwork skills help individuals manage the unique challenges of remote work and extended rosters. These abilities ensure safety, productivity, and well-being while living and working away from home for extended periods.

What are some key challenges faced by employees in a Seasonal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) role, and how can they be managed?

One of the main challenges in a Seasonal FIFO position is adapting to extended periods away from home, which can affect work-life balance and personal relationships. Additionally, adjusting to a structured roster, often involving long shifts and remote work environments, can be demanding physically and mentally. To manage these challenges, many employers offer support such as mental health resources, comfortable accommodations, and clear communication channels. Building strong connections with team members and maintaining regular contact with loved ones can also help foster a positive experience.

What are Seasonal Fly In Fly Out jobs?

Seasonal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) jobs are temporary positions where employees are flown to remote work locations for a set period, such as several weeks or months, and then flown back home for a break. These roles are common in industries like mining, construction, and agriculture, especially in regions that are difficult to access daily. Workers typically stay in employer-provided accommodations and work long shifts during their rostered period. Seasonal FIFO jobs are popular for those seeking higher pay and flexible work schedules, but they can involve extended time away from home and family.

What is the difference between Seasonal Fly In Fly Out vs Seasonal Mining Worker?

AspectSeasonal Fly In Fly OutSeasonal Mining Worker
Work EnvironmentRemote locations, often in resource-rich areas, with temporary housingMining sites, often remote, with shift-based schedules
CredentialsVaries; often includes safety certifications, but not always specializedSafety training and certifications specific to mining operations
Industry UsageCommon in resource extraction sectors like oil, gas, and mineralsPrimarily in mining and mineral extraction industries

Seasonal Fly In Fly Out workers typically travel temporarily to remote work sites, often for resource industries, with flexible certifications. Seasonal Mining Workers are specifically employed in mining operations, requiring industry-specific safety credentials. Both roles involve remote work environments but differ in industry focus and certification requirements.
